ERF function: Description, Usage, Syntax, Examples and Explanation

by

What is ERF function in Excel?

ERF function is one of Engineering functions in Microsoft Excel that returns the error function integrated between lower_limit and upper_limit.

Syntax of ERF function

ERF(lower_limit,[upper_limit])

The ERF function syntax has the following arguments:

  • Lower_limit: The lower bound for integrating ERF.
  • Upper_limit(Optional): The upper bound for integrating ERF. If omitted, ERF integrates between zero and lower_limit.

ERF formula explanation

  • If lower_limit is nonnumeric, ERF returns the #VALUE! error value.
  • If upper_limit is nonnumeric, ERF returns the #VALUE! error value.

Example of ERF function

Steps to follow:

1. Open a new Excel worksheet.

2. Copy data in the following table below and paste it in cell A1

Note: For formulas to show results, select them, press F2 key on your keyboard and then press Enter.

You can adjust the column widths to see all the data, if  need be.

Formula Description Result
=ERF(0.745) Error function integrated between 0 and 0.74500 0.70792892
=ERF(1) Error function integrated between 0 and 1. 0.84270079
